Control Power Transformer (CPTR) Option
The CPTR option provides a means to isolate the incoming
line voltage required for the chiller control circuits and the
oil/refrigerant pump from the compressor incoming line
voltage. The CPTR option provides a solution for
customers that cannot afford to lose communication with
the chiller or extended restart times due to lost incoming
power.
The CPTR option will benefit:
• UPS customers
• Customers requiring fast restarts
• Customers who need controls sourced from a clean
dedicated source
• Customers with building automation/communication
systems who want to maintain chiller status reporting
during power loss
• Chillers with remote-mounted medium-voltage AFDs
or customer-supplied starters
The standard unit-mounted CPTR option shall have an
enclosure with a disconnect and will require customer-
supplied power.
CVHH and CDHH chillers have a low-voltage CPTR option
and a medium-voltage CPTR option.
The CPTR option involves a single phase 4kVA
transformer(s) and the oil pum p motor circuit to be located
together in an enclosure that is unit-mounted. There is
3-phase line power between 380–600 Vac feeding this
enclosure. Wherever the 4kVA transformer is located, the
oil pump motor circuit will be located along with it.
With the CPTR option, the control power transformer(s)
and oil pump motor circuit are NOT inside of the starter.
For the low-voltage CPTR option, the single phase 4kVA
transformer feeds the 120 V control power to all of the
controls. The three-phase line power feeds a motor starter
and overload oil pump motor circuit which feeds the
three-phase oil pump motor.
For the medium-voltage CPTR option, there are two single-
phase 4-kVA transformers: one of the 4 kVA transformers
feeds the 120 V control power to all of the controls. The
second transformer feeds a combination motor controller
oil pump motor circuit which then feeds a single-phase oil
pump motor.
Note: Refer to the unit nameplate for maximum
overcurrent protection and minimum current
ampacity values for connecting to the CPTR option
enclosure.
Service personnel are required to ensure that the
incoming power supply voltage provided by the customer
to the CPTR option enclosure unit-mounted panel is as per
submittal and nameplate.
Power Factor Correction
Capacitors (Optional)
Power factor correction capacitors (PFCCs) are designed to
provide power factor correction for the compressor motor.
PFCCs are available as an option for unit-mounted starters
and remote mounted starters.
Notes:
• Verify PFCC voltage rating is greater than or equal to
the compressor voltage rating stamped on the unit
nameplate.
• Refer to the wiring diagrams that shipped with the unit
for specific PFCC wiring information.
